Quest Sprout Amigurumi Pattern
The pattern is available as a free PDF on Ravelry.
Check out my other patterns on Ravelry and Etsy.
Quest Sprout from the Swords webcomics. Just the cutest little guy. Qwest!
This is an icrochetthings original pattern © 2023. For personal use only. Do not copy, sell, alter, or distribute this pattern or parts of it. You may sell a limited number of your handmade finished items provided you credit icrochetthings as the designer.
Size: 4” tall
Materials:
• DK weight yarn in light green, dark green, yellow, brown, black, white • C (2.75mm) crochet hook • Stuffing • Scissors • Yarn needle

Legacy of a King by TIA INTERNATIONAL PHOTOGRAPHY Via Flickr: Enjoy an early evening view of downtown Seattle from the Beacon Hill neighborhood. Here in the States, we will observe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. Day on Monday, January 16th. The City of Seattle itself is the county seat of King County, Washington. The county was initially named in dedication to Vice President William Rufus King (who retains the record as the U.S. Vice President with the shortest term in office of only 45 days). Vice President King, under the presidency of Franklin Pierce, was a strong advocate of slavery in the nation, and opposed all efforts for the movements to abolish slavery. He was also a slave owner, and one of the founders of Selma, Alabama (another town with its own profound history in civil rights and race relations). The King County Council elected to have the county’s name rededicated in honor of Martin Luther King, Jr. in 1986, the year the USA first initially observed the third Monday of each January as the national holiday. There was plenty of controversy in ratifying the holiday. Even President Ronald Reagan, who passed the motion into law, was not altogether pleased in creating a holiday for MLK. The states of Arizona, New Hampshire, and South Carolina initially refused to observe it, and it wasn’t until the year 2000 that every state in the nation officially observed the day. King County’s name was officially ratified by Washington Governor Christine Gregoire in 2005, a decision that had to be passed by the state, not the county, which is probably part of the reason the rededication took nearly 20 years to officially be recognized. On March 12, 2007, five days before I relocated to Seattle from D.C., the official logo of King County was changed to an image of MLK. As a result, King County, Washington is the first county in the USA whose government decided to switch its own logo (originally a golden crown) into the image of one of the nation’s most internationally renowned civil rights activists. Quincy Jones' Qwest TV Debuts One Night Stand Docu-Series
Tumblr media
Quincy Jones's QWEST TV has debuted One Night Stand, a new docu-series that pairs two very different artists together for each episode. The collaborations are designed to bring about cultural exchange and each one is spontaneous, without the artists knowing who they will work with and no live audience. The first episode aired on November 17th and it featured 92-year-old composer David Aram, who played with Dizzy Gillespie in the 1950s and singer-songwriter Cheyenne Mize. The second episode features musician Seun Kuti who is the son of Afrobeat pioneer Fela Kuti and 18-year-old drum prodigy Kojo Roney. Meshell Ndegeocello is scheduled to appear on an episode in 2023. One episode per month will air on QWEST TV.  For more information about QWEST TV check out the official site.
